Transaction 31bb4c12801919489f5aa55eb537bcb5b72f6d8d2528a8ae5401b16702309d28
1 Input
1 Output
-
31bb4c12801919489f5aa55eb537bcb5b72f6d8d2528a8ae5401b16702309d28:0
- value
- 328098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 850b1fb8c9a6f35aea4b0d2acbaa99b82ad11f18 OP_EQUAL
- address
- 3DpV7xeYGjXkh6nDjimKNmRBuYVT1iaNWV